## Onboarding: Liftplan Dispatch Simulator

Sim runs against recorded traffic from the Corvalle tower dataset. Set SIM_CAR_COUNT=8 and SIM_TICK_MS=100 for standard runs; deterministic mode needs SIM_SEED. Results stream to the shared scoreboard, and the simulator authenticates to it with a token the env file sets on the next line.

vault entry, yajop-bafop: ARCHIVE_KEY3=8d4

Ticket #— Floor 9 Opening Prep, Brindlemoor House

Hi facilities folks, Floor 9 opens to staff next Monday and we need a few things squared away before then. Lift access is live, but the two side doors by the kitchenette are still on the old lock config — please reprogram them before Friday. Also, signage for the quiet rooms hasn't arrived, so pop up the temporary printed ones for now. Until the badge readers sync, the interim door code for Floor 9 is below.

door code, bajop-bajog: bdg-DSWAC-43621

**Ticket: AddressPilot widget acting weird on staging**

Hey folks — the AddressPilot autocomplete on the Quellford storefront is suggesting results from the wrong region again. Looks like classic config drift: someone hot-patched staging last sprint and it never got synced back. Prod and staging now disagree on at least three settings, so please don't "fix" anything by copying blindly. For reference, here's what staging is currently running with.

settings of tajof-fajep:
BRIWYN_PIN=8552
BRIWYN_TENANT=istion
BRIWYN_METRICS_HOST=metrics.briwyn.olvarqlabs.test
BRIWYN_SEAL=seal_46778c01
BRIWYN_STANDBY_TEAM=silok

Quarterly Planning Note — FY Headcount

Korrindale Group proposes 34 net adds next year: 18 engineering, 9 field sales, 7 operations. Attrition assumed at 11%. Backfills frozen in the Telmark unit pending the margin review. Cost impact within envelope approved in March. CFO L. Brannvik endorses. Board sign-off requested this cycle. A restricted note on strategic intent is appended below for board members only.

board note of bawep-tajef: Queniusek Systems plans to raise the Quenvan list price by 53.1 percent in March. The pricing group signed off on a budget of $176.4 million for Project Drueth. The renewal with Casionix Partners closes at $142.5 million a year, 8.3 percent below the last contract. Project Fraax slips by six weeks because of the tooling delay.